Something Different: Star Wars ‘ The Rise of Skywalker ‘

So the final part of the Skywalker saga has arrived, or a couple of weeks ago but I just got around to going to see it today.

I had been able to avoid the reviews and the comments by people who had seen the film so I was able to go in with an open mind, while not expecting all that much to be honest. The film included the final time that Carrie Fisher (Princess Leia Organa) starred in a movie and handled her passing very well to finish off the story using unused scenes from previous films. This final film in the saga sees Rey, Poe, and Finn go up against the resurrected Palpatine and Kylo Ren. Billy D Williams returned as Lando Calrissian and does a decent job but doesn’t really add anything to the film other than tidy up some loose ends I suppose. The special effects were excellent as you would expect and the story not as bad as I as I feared although there is some cheese, some aspects that will have no doubt upset the Star Wars fanatics, and some things that were just plain stupid or didn’t make any sense.

JJ Abrams who directed the Force Awakens returned to direct this final film and does an ok job overall. The film was not really inspiring and suffers from average story telling by Abrams and too many characters, too many locations and came across as a little confused at times. The film has had mixed reviews from critics but pretty positive reviews from fans overall. For myself the film is ok, it ended the saga but I won’t say that it did in an exciting and satisfactory way, the previous two films just didn’t help at all but the film will make money and no doubt there will be some sort of Star Wars film in the future but who knows which direction that will go down or it might end up being prequels non stop.
